Przemysław (Polish: [pʂɛˈmɘ.swaf] ) is a Polish masculine given name. It is derived from the Polish name Przemysł, cognate to Czech Přemysl, and the common Slavic element sława meaning "glory, fame".[1]. It means "someone who is clever or ingenious" or "famous for being clever".

Diminutive forms include Przemek and Przemuś (hypocorism). The feminine form of the name is Przemysława.

Name days

Individuals named Przemysław may choose their name day from the following dates: April 13, September 4, October 10, or October 30.
